The NELAC Institute (TNI) is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ization founded in 2006, with a mission to foster the generation of environmental data of known and documented quality. TNI aims to create a national accreditation program for all entities involved in the generation of environmental measurement data within the United States. This program is designed to be uniform, rigorous, and consistently implemented nationwide, focusing on the technical competence of the entities seeking accreditation. TNI believes that such a program will enhance the quality and reliability of environmental data used by federal and state agencies. TNI membership is open to individuals interested in laboratory accreditation in the private, public, or academic sectors. There are various types of memberships available, including Individual, Partner, Sponsor, Patron, Consulting Firm, and Corporate Sponsor. The organization relies on its members, who work on Committees tasked with specific functions, to carry out most of its work.
